Understanding Flat Washers
Flat washers are typically circular disks made from materials like metal, plastic, or rubber. Their primary function is to provide a smooth bearing surface for screw or bolt heads and to create a uniform bearing surface that aids in the effective distribution of force. This is particularly important in applications where heavy loads are present. Challenges Faced by Exporters
While the export market for flat washers offers significant opportunities, it is not without challenges. Trade regulations, fluctuations in raw material prices, and competition from local manufacturers can pose hurdles for exporters. Additionally, the ongoing shifts in global relations and trade agreements can impact pricing and availability.
Quality control is another critical area for exporters. Ensuring that products meet international standards is essential, as failure to comply can result in costly recalls and damage to brand reputation. Continuous investment in quality assurance processes is vital for maintaining competitiveness in the global market.
